This property, a 65 square meters flat in London, was built between 1930-1949, making it a historic home. It's an end-terrace flat with fully triple-glazed windows, which helps reduce energy costs. The property has a current energy rating of 'C' and a potential energy rating of 'C', indicating a moderate energy efficiency. The main heating system is boiler and radiators, powered by mains gas. The energy costs are £627 per year, with a potential reduction of £479. The property has a flood risk, but this is currently classified as'very low'.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 871 out of 999.
